# TilePull Prefetcher — Runbook

TilePull warms the map-tile cache ahead of Ardenport commuter peaks. Config is env-only; no files on disk. Verify `TILE_ORIGIN` and `PREFETCH_DEPTH` before restart. Reviewer note: egress is restricted to the origin host; confirm the firewall policy matches. Rotation cadence for credentials is 90 days. The last line of the env file sets the origin access secret, as follows.

env line for fafof-fahag: LEDGER_TOKEN5=f8790

## Runbook: Clock skew between build agents

Symptom: Brindlehook CI builds fail signature checks or report out-of-order artifacts. Cause: agent clocks drifting past the 2s tolerance. Check skew via the agent status page; anything over 2s, force an NTP resync and restart the agent daemon. If drift recurs within an hour, cordon the agent and file with platform. Skew metrics are queried from the internal ChronoGate service, which requires a key, included here.

API key for fawep-kahog: vxb15-oGAHe8SEMmJYYhd

## Deploying the Gatewick Proctor Queue

Deploys are pretty painless: push to main, wait for the pipeline, then watch the queue drain dashboard for five minutes. If candidates pile up mid-exam, roll back first and ask questions later — the queue replays safely. Everything the workers care about lives in one config block, shown here for reference.

settings of bafof-yagef:
JOROX_PIN=8740
JOROX_TENANT=pelox
JOROX_METRICS_HOST=metrics.jorox.qorvelworks.internal
JOROX_SEAL=seal_c78f63c1
JOROX_STANDBY_TEAM=norax

All feature flags previously managed in Togglewick must be re-declared in Rolloutry before the old evaluator is decommissioned. Flags controlling authentication, session handling, or data export require explicit security review, since Rolloutry evaluates rules client-side by default. Confirm that each migrated flag retains its original kill-switch behavior and that stale Togglewick entries are archived, not deleted. The Rolloutry evaluator connects to the control plane using the configuration below.

config for tagep-yajef:
ulawyn:
  log_level: error
  metrics_host: metrics.ulawyn.lumiclabs.internal
  pin: 0564
  pool_size: 32